Output f593db87dc2a53a5c32593f5bca08767ddbac9595d332938da170682269b261a:1

value
952254904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1df8bd231f6bc8299601c7d2992bfc3eba6f8d8 OP_EQUALVERIFY OP_CHECKSIG
address
1MbJqRW9QBnikFoK1wJ1h6vNtxgXgRwwYB
transaction
f593db87dc2a53a5c32593f5bca08767ddbac9595d332938da170682269b261a
confirmations
490202
spent
true